Tasks

-Assist and provide backup support to other deskside team members as needed. -Collaborate across TS teams to resolve complex or escalated issues efficiently. -Install, configure, maintain, and troubleshoot hardware, software, peripherals, AV equipment, and network connectivity. -Support high-priority and complex technical issues, including escalations. -Own IT supports incidents and requests through to confirmed resolution. -Deliver basic onboarding technical training and guidance to end users. -Participate in the testing and rollout of new desktop technologies and software. -Represent Brookfield Technology Services with professionalism in all interactions. -Ensure all incidents, resolutions, and workarounds are documented in accordance with knowledge management standards. -Provide exceptional deskside and remote support to Brookfield end users.

What You Bring

-Operating Systems: Windows 10/11 and macOS -Server OS knowledge is an asset -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, or related field, or equivalent combination of education, certifications, and experience -Detail-Oriented – Listens carefully, documents thoroughly, and follows up consistently. -Systems & Tools: Active Directory, Microsoft Intune, Azure AD -Experience in the financial services industry is preferred; front-office support is a plus -Experience working with third-party service providers and ticketing systems (e.g., ServiceNow) -3-6 years of relevant IT support experience -Strong awareness and commitment to cybersecurity best practices -Strong customer service and relationship management skills -ITIL framework and best practices -Proven ability to install, configure, and support both Windows and Mac environments -CompTIA A+ / Network+ -Networking: Remote access (MFA, Zscaler), TCP/IP, WAN -Professionalism – Maintains composure and integrity in all user interactions.

About Brookfield

-The company manages a diversified portfolio across real estate, infrastructure, renewable power, and private equity. -Brookfield is known for its strategic investments in large-scale assets that drive long-term value. -Its diverse real estate portfolio spans office towers, residential complexes, retail spaces, and logistics hubs. -Notably, Brookfield has made substantial investments in renewable energy, including wind, solar, and hydroelectric projects. -The firm has built a reputation for its ability to manage complex, large-scale infrastructure projects worldwide. -Brookfield has been instrumental in major developments like the World Financial Center in New York and London's Canary Wharf. -The company is renowned for creating and managing sustainable, high-value assets across key sectors of the global economy. -Brookfield is also focused on growing its presence in emerging markets, capitalizing on growth opportunities in Asia and Latin America.
